快播视频 researchers are at the centre of an ambitious partnership driven by advanced technology and community engagement to address environmental challenges at Swan Lake Park in Markham.

Several times a month, a small drone rises above the trees at Swan Lake, following a precise path over the water. Parkgoers who enjoy walking, jogging or birdwatching might assume it鈥檚 there to capture scenic footage. Instead, the drone is part of a 快播视频-led effort to understand 鈥 and help restore 鈥 the health of an urban lake under pressure.

Swan Lake, a former gravel pit transformed into a stormwater pond and community green space, faces ongoing water quality challenges. As rainwater flows into the site from surrounding roads and neighbourhoods, it carries excess nutrients, road salt and other pollutants. Over time, this can fuel frequent algae growth, cloud the water and reduce oxygen levels, stressing fish and wildlife, limiting recreation and, in some cases, raising public health concerns.

Since April 2025, 快播视频 researchers, led by CIFAL York, have been turning concern about the lake鈥檚 health into measurable data and practical action through the Swan Lake Citizen Science Lab (SLCS Lab). The initiative brings together York research centres, including ADERSIM and the One WATER Institute, with local partners such as Friends of Swan Lake Park, a community鈥慴ased volunteer organization dedicated to protecting and improving the area鈥檚 ecological health.

鈥淐ommunities often know when something is not right with a local ecosystem, but it鈥檚 hard to act without clear, comprehensive and consistent information, as well as meaningful community engagement鈥 says Ali Asgary, director of CIFAL York and professor in the Faculty of Liberal Arts & Professional Studies. 鈥淭he goal of the lab is to support those concerns with reliable data that can guide real decisions.鈥

"To assess a lake is to assess ourselves," adds Satinder Kaur Brar, director of the One WATER Institute and professor at the . "Its health card is a mirror of our environmental stewardship."

Ali Asgary (centre), with one of the drones used to analyze Swan Lake.

One way the lab is assessing the lake is through advanced technology, such as the use of multispectral and thermal drones operated by York research teams.

Equipped with special cameras that capture different types of light 鈥 including some invisible to the human eye 鈥 the drones can detect potential algae growth and subtle changes in water clarity as they scan the lake from above. Flying low and on demand, they provide detailed, up-to-date views of trends across the entire water body, offering a clearer picture than satellite images and a broader perspective than scattered and spot鈥慴y鈥憇pot water sampling.

The drones have already yielded valuable insights, recently shared in a York鈥憀ed, under-review study that monitored patterns from spring through fall 2025. By flying the drones roughly once a month and analyzing the findings over time, researchers were able to pinpoint where algae forms, how blooms shift across the seasons and how changes in water cloudiness are driven by biological growth rather than stirred鈥憉p sediment.

The findings confirm what many residents and park managers have long suspected: the lake is rich in nutrients and prone to recurring algae growth. The drone data, however, also reveal something new.

Conditions vary significantly from one area to another, suggesting that targeted, location鈥憇pecific interventions may be more effective than broad, one鈥憇ize鈥慺its鈥慳ll treatments applied across the entire lake. Knowing where problems emerge helps guide chemical treatments, shoreline naturalization projects and future restoration efforts 鈥 and provides a better way to measure whether those interventions are working. "Interconnecting drone data with on-ground water quality can turn ecological signals into informed action that is vital for communities," says Brar.

鈥淲hat the data made clear is that this isn鈥檛 a uniform problem,鈥 adds Asgary. 鈥淲hen conditions vary so much from one part of the lake to another, it changes how you think about solutions. This kind of information allows us to be more precise, more proactive and more strategic in environmental management.鈥

In addition to monitoring Swan Lake, York鈥憀ed teams are working to make the data easier to interpret and use in planning. Researchers are developing AI tools to identify patterns in the drone imagery, anticipate conditions such as algae outbreaks and translate complex trends into clearer insights.

Other teams are using virtual reality and simulation to help users visualize the lake over time and explore how different interventions might affect conditions. Meanwhile, geographic information system (GIS) specialists are turning the results into interactive maps and dashboards that help the public and those involved in lake management understand what is happening across the site.

Through a new partnership, the Multicultural History Society of Ontario (MHSO) based at 快播视频鈥檚 Keele Campus is expanding public access to its historical newspapers documenting immigrant and racialized communities.

In collaboration with Internet Archive Canada, a non-profit digital library, the MHSO is making its collection of multicultural newspapers 鈥 one of the most comprehensive in the country, with titles dating back to the 19th century 鈥 freely accessible online to scholars, educators and the public.

Housed within the offices of 快播视频鈥檚 Institute for Social Research (ISR), the MHSO鈥檚 archive was previously hosted by Simon Fraser University Library but is now migrating to a centralized, open-access platform designed to ensure long-term preservation and improve discoverability.

The initiative has launched with 鈥 The New Canadian, The Canadian Jewish Review, The Canadian Jewish News and L鈥橝mi du Peuple 鈥 which document the experiences of Japanese Canadian, Jewish Canadian and Franco Ontarian communities.

Additional titles, including Chinese Canadian Community News and The Chinese Times, are being added, with more publications from the MHSO鈥檚 extensive collection to follow.

鈥淓thnic and francophone newspapers were vital instruments for community members to engage with and express their views on contemporary events,鈥 says Julia Rady, Chair and president of MHSO. 鈥淭hrough our collaboration with Internet Archive Canada, there is now a single platform for people to discover and research these important resources, helping to preserve their legacy for generations to come.鈥

Lorne Foster
Lorne Foster

鈥淭his partnership significantly expands access to rare and historically important primary sources,鈥 says Lorne Foster, director of ISR. 鈥淔or York researchers 鈥 and scholars at other institutions 鈥 it supports new and existing work in areas such as migration and diaspora studies, history, sociology and equity-focused research.鈥

Beyond preservation and access, the collaboration also creates opportunities for student engagement. Under its agreement with York, the MHSO provides orientation and training for students working with its archives, supports work-study and co-op placements, and connects students with community historians and organizations. York is also represented on the MHSO鈥檚 board of directors.

The development builds on York鈥檚 and the MHSO鈥檚 shared leadership in digital research and cultural preservation. The ISR helped bring the MHSO to York鈥檚 Keele Campus in 2023, contributing to a growing digital ecosystem that includes searchable archives of oral histories, newspapers, photographs and textual records documenting the experiences of ethnocultural and Indigenous communities across Ontario.

鈥淏y supporting open, digital access to these materials,鈥 says Foster, 鈥渢he initiative helps preserve and amplify the histories of underrepresented communities in Canada, while highlighting the University鈥檚 role in fostering inclusive research infrastructure through its hosting of the MHSO and its connections with community-based knowledge.鈥

Two 快播视频 chemists are among the recipients of one of NASA's highest honours for their role in a major North American air quality campaign 鈥 work that could help improve how wildfire smoke risks are understood and communicated in Canada.

Faculty of Science Professor Cora Young and Associate Professor Trevor VandenBoer were recognized through the NASA Group Achievement Award for their contributions to the Atmospheric Emissions and Reactions Observed from Megacities to Marine Areas (AEROMMA) campaign, a joint effort between NASA and the The National Oceanic and Atmospheric Administration (NOAA) to study air quality and climate interactions across North America.

The award is reserved for those who have made exceptional contributions to NASA's mission and scientific endeavours.

AEROMMA combined aircraft, ground-based measurements and satellite observations to study how contemporary emissions from cities and oceans affect air quality and climate. NASA and NOAA approached York to lead the Toronto supersite, one of several measurement hubs established in major North American cities to contribute to the campaign's airborne data.

Young served as scientific lead, coordinating a team of 25 to 30 researchers; VandenBoer served as logistical lead, overseeing the physical transformation of York's rooftop laboratory 鈥 on the Petrie Science and Engineering Building 鈥 to host the research.

Also involved were York colleagues Mark Gordon, associate professor at the , and Rob McLaren, professor emeritus in the Department of Chemistry.

The 2023 summer AEROMMA project unfolded during a period of intense wildfire smoke across the region, an unplanned development that offered a rare opportunity for study.

"Wildfires will exacerbate air quality issues," says VandenBoer. "Understanding the chemistry of wildfire plumes arriving in the city is going to be critical to informing the public on when and how to protect their respiratory health."

The existing Air Quality Health Index is not well-suited to wildfire conditions because the smoke differs from the other drivers of urban air pollution.

One of the first papers to emerge from the project, now in its final round of peer review, found that wildfire smoke changed chemically as it travelled, changing how health and climate impacts are understood and communicated.

York researchers have also been in dialogue with the team behind ECCC鈥檚 2024 快播视频 of Winter Air Pollution in Toronto (SWAPIT). Together, the summer and winter datasets create a year-round picture of urban air quality in Canada鈥檚 largest city that could inform policy on everything from wood-burning smoke to the atmospheric impacts of road salt.

The work also validated NASA鈥檚 TEMPO satellite, a space-based instrument tracking air pollution across North America. Measurements from York鈥檚 site, alongside NASA research aircraft and ECCC sites, were essential in confirming the satellite鈥檚 early readings, helping move the tool into practical use for ongoing air-quality monitoring and research.

快播视频 is among the recipients of federal clean energy funding, with $695,000 awarded to support research advancing next鈥慻eneration carbon dioxide capture technology at the .

Announced March 27 at York鈥檚 Markham Campus, Natural Resources Canada will invest $28.9 million in 12 projects across the country to build and deploy clean energy technologies through its Energy Innovation Program.

These investments support efforts to reduce emissions and modernize Canada鈥檚 energy systems as clean technologies advance.

York's project, led by Associate Professor Marina Freire鈥慓ormaly at Lassonde, is one of four initiatives funded in the Carbon Capture, Utilization and Storage stream which supports early research on capturing, moving, story and reusing carbon dioxide.

Tim Hodgson, minister of energy and natural resources, with Associate Professor Marina Freire鈥慓ormaly
Tim Hodgson, minister of energy and natural resources, with Associate Professor Marina Freire鈥慓ormaly during the announcement

Freire-Gormaly will focus on developing a carbon capture technology that replaces heat鈥慽ntensive systems with electrochemical and light鈥慸riven processes. By using advanced materials, the technology aims to cut energy use, reduce operating costs and improve performance.

鈥淭his funding allows us to move promising carbon capture ideas from the lab and scale them up, closer to real鈥憌orld use,鈥 says Freire鈥慓ormaly. 鈥淚t supports York鈥檚 role in developing practical, low鈥慹nergy solutions that can help reduce emissions.鈥

The project, titled 鈥淒evelopment and scale-up of novel solid C02 capture photoelectrochemical active sorbents,鈥 began in 2023 and will continue until March 2027 with a focus on creating and testing new solid materials that absorb carbon dioxide when exposed to light and electricity, instead of through thermal processes.

Freire鈥慓ormaly and her team of researchers 鈥 including co-applicant Assistant Professor Solomon Boakye-Yiadom and other collaborators at York's Faculty of Science 鈥 have developed new electrode materials using copper, aerogels and specialized coatings to improve performance.

Researchers are using a small, custom-built lab to accurately measure how much carbon dioxide is captured. Findings will help evaluate costs, environmental impacts and carbon emissions, and help determine how sustainable and practical the innovative solvent-based pathway would be at an industrial scale.

As cities around the world grapple with mounting waste crises, researchers at the York Centre for Asian Research (YCAR) are exploring a critical but often overlooked question: who does the work of managing waste and under what conditions?

At 快播视频, this question is shaping an emerging area of interdisciplinary research that connects environmental change with labour, inequality and shared global priorities.

Shubhra Gururani
Shubhra Gururani

Research efforts led by Shubhra Gururani, a political ecologist, associate professor of anthropology and director of YCAR, examine how waste is a technical or environmental problem, but also a deeply political one, structured by histories of colonialism, race, caste and gender.

Waste is increasing at an unprecedented rate, expected to grow by around 80 per cent by 2050, according to the United Nations Environment Programme. 鈥淭he systems that manage that growth still often rely on precarious labour performed by socially marginalized groups, including migrants, women and caste-oppressed communities,鈥 says Gururani, who explores how these dynamics are embedded in broader processes of urban change and development. "This raises urgent questions about whether shifts to more environmentally sustainable systems may reproduce, rather than resolve, entrenched inequalities.鈥

A key contributor is Harsha Anantharaman, a postdoctoral Asian studies fellow at YCAR who focuses on informal waste workers 鈥 those who make a living by collecting and recycling waste outside formal, regulated systems 鈥 in urban India.

Drawing on extensive ethnographic and archival research across four cities for an ongoing book project 鈥 To Caste Away Waste: Racialized Labour and the Political Economy of Commodity Detritus in Urban India 鈥 Anantharaman studies how policies aimed at formalizing waste work often have contradictory effects. 鈥淎s formalization policies reshape urban waste economies in India, the efforts to include marginalized groups can paradoxically deepen labour precarity and reproduce entrenched caste hierarchies,鈥 he says.

His research shows that initiatives framed as inclusive, such as bringing waste pickers into formal waste management systems, can make working conditions more insecure. As municipal waste becomes increasingly controlled by governments and corporations as a private resource, informal workers are incorporated into systems that offer recognition without security. These processes reproduce caste-based hierarchies, reshaping labour relations. Anantharaman describes this as informal labour being absorbed into systems while caste-coded recognition continues.

Harsha Anantharaman
Harsha Anantharaman

By situating these dynamics within global political economic transformations in urban governance and political economy, his work highlights both the structural constraints faced by workers and the potential for more equitable alternatives. His findings suggest models such as the formal recognition and integration of waste pickers into municipal systems, cooperative-led recycling initiatives and policies that ensure fair wages, social protections and decision-making power for frontline workers.

Through these efforts, Gururani and Anantharaman鈥檚 work can contribute to a growing international conversation on the global politics of waste. It brings into focus how environmental governance, labour regimes and social hierarchies intersect in ways that challenge dominant narratives as municipalities and corporations transition to green and sustainable efforts.

鈥淚t is critical to remain cognizant of the ways in which such transitions often rely on the invisibilized labour of marginalized communities and reproduce existing inequalities even as they claim ecological progress,鈥 says Anantharaman.

快播视频 researchers are using advanced simulation to study how emergency response decisions shape airport safety and preparedness.
Ali Asgary
Ali Asgary

Emergency management at airports is uniquely demanding because of the complex, diverse and dynamic systems involved, says Ali Asgary, professor of disaster and emergency management in the Faculty of Liberal Arts & Professional Studies.

With dense traffic, multiple vehicles and operations often unfolding during changing or extreme weather, coordinating airside and landside activity remains a major challenge.

鈥淓ven a small emergency at an airport can have significant political consequences and cascading impacts,鈥 Asgary says. 鈥淭hese are the dynamics that shape airport emergencies, runway incidents and large鈥憇cale disruptions to air transportation.鈥

Asgary's research has gained renewed relevance amid the March 22 Air Canada collision between an aircraft and a fire truck on a runway at LaGuardia Airport. While investigations are ongoing, the fatal incident underscores how seconds matter during runway operations.

While it鈥檚 still too early to determine what led to the tragedy, Asgary says events often involve factors that emergency managers and aviation operators routinely study: real-time hazard assessment, workloads, communication and warning systems.

鈥淩unway incidents often involve overlapping risks, including split鈥憇econd decision鈥憁aking, heavy controller workload and limited redundancy in warning systems,鈥 he says. 鈥淲hen warning systems rely on a single communication channel, missed messages can quickly escalate into serious incidents.鈥

Asgary is executive director of 鈥 the Advanced Disaster, Emergency and Rapid Response Simulation lab at 快播视频 鈥 where researchers and students simulate disasters and test response plans before they emerge in real鈥憌orld settings.

At ADERSIM, researchers use agent-based models to simulate aviation scenarios and examine how decisions by pilots, passengers, crew and ground emergency responders influence outcomes.

The lab incorporates virtual reality to help emergency managers visualize airport events and uses AI to analyze disruption patterns. It also explores how tools such as drones could support airside emergency response and risk assessment.

ADERSIM has also developed AeroHaz, a web-mapping application that identifies major hazards for airports worldwide to support hazard awareness and planning.

鈥淭hrough a combination of computer modelling, human鈥慽n鈥憈he鈥憀oop simulations, extended reality and AI, we can test how emergency response systems behave when multiple risks converge and conditions change rapidly,鈥 says Asgary. 鈥淭he work of ADERSIM contributes to York's leadership in disaster and emergency management.鈥

Major runway incidents can yield lessons for emergency preparedness 鈥 but only if they are researched, documented and incorporated into revised procedures. The incident also highlights the need for more research into the technological and human factors driving airport safety.

鈥淪imulation-driven research allows emergency planners and responders to review how decisions are made, how workflows unfold in crisis situations and how to improve preparedness,鈥 says Asgary.

快播视频 has launched a new public resource designed to help people better understand electric vehicle (EV) charging and make practical decisions about where and how to charge.

The initiative, led by Hany Farag, a professor in the , is supported by a $139,294 federal grant from Natural Resources Canada through its Zero Emission Vehicle Awareness Initiative, which funds education projects that support cleaner transportation.

Hany Farag
Hany Farag

"The hub is meant to serve a wide range of audiences, from everyday drivers and prospective buyers to building managers and municipalities planning for more charging infrastructure," says Farag.

The is an online platform that combines plain-language explainers with interactive tools. It helps users explore common questions, such as how long charging might take in different situations or what it can cost to install a faster charger at home. It is designed as a practical starting point for anyone trying to make sense of EV charging without a technical background.

The site is organized into two main parts. The first features short explainations and briefs answering common questions about charger types, home charging and why charging speeds sometimes vary. Users can also download information as PDFs. The second section is a growing set of interactive tools that help users explore real scenarios, such as a charging simulator that estimates how a vehicle's battery level changes over time during a session.

"A key aim of the project is to also address common misconceptions that can make EV charging seem more complicated or intimidating than it needs to be," says Farag.

The hub reflects the University鈥檚 deep research strengths in clean energy systems 鈥 grounding EV charging within the broader electricity infrastructure that powers homes, buildings and communities. It supports diverse settings, including condos and apartment buildings, where planning becomes more complex when multiple residents charge simultaneously within a building's power capacity limits.
